引言
Vega Strike 是一款免费、开源的 3D 太空模拟游戏和引擎,它为玩家提供了一个广阔的宇宙,可以在其中进行贸易、战斗、探索和执行任务。基于 C++ 和 OpenGL 构建,Vega Strike 不仅仅是一款游戏,更是一个可扩展的框架,允许开发者和社区创建自己的太空冒险内容。项目源代码托管在 GitHub 上,遵循 GPL 协议。
主要特性
Vega Strike 提供了丰富的太空模拟体验,其核心特性包括:
- 广阔的宇宙与自由探索: 游戏设定在一个动态生成的宇宙中,包含众多星系、行星、空间站和派系。玩家拥有高度的自由度,可以选择自己的道路,无论是成为一名商人、赏金猎人、矿工还是探险家。
- 核心游戏循环 (贸易、战斗、探索):
- 贸易: 复杂的经济系统允许玩家在不同星系间买卖商品,寻找利润丰厚的贸易路线。
- 战斗: 基于牛顿物理学的飞行模型提供了具有挑战性的太空战斗体验。玩家可以装备各种武器和防御系统,并需要掌握能量管理和战术机动。
- 探索与任务: 玩家可以接受各种任务,从简单的货物运送到复杂的剧情任务,逐步揭开宇宙的秘密或影响不同派系的关系。
- 模块化与可定制性: Vega Strike 引擎被设计为模块化和可扩展的。这不仅方便了核心开发团队维护和添加新功能,也为社区 Modding 提供了强大的基础。
- 强大的 Mod 支持: 这是 Vega Strike 最显著的优势之一。活跃的社区创造了大量的 Mod,包括:
- 高清纹理包和图形改进。
- 新的飞船、武器和装备。
- 自定义任务和故事情节。
- 完整的“全面转换”(Total Conversion)Mod,创建全新的游戏体验。
- 许多玩家认为,正是 Mod 社区让这款游戏保持着活力和吸引力。
- 跨平台: Vega Strike 可在 Windows、macOS 和 Linux 上运行。
- 技术基础: 使用 C++ 编写,利用 OpenGL 进行图形渲染,并采用自定义场景图管理游戏对象。
安装与快速入门
你可以从 Vega Strike 的官方网站或 SourceForge 页面下载适用于你操作系统的最新版本。
- 官方网站/下载: https://vegastrike.sourceforge.net/ (请注意,截至 2025 年初,官方网站和开发活动可能需要通过 GitHub 或社区论坛获取最新信息)
- 源代码: https://github.com/vegastrike/Vega-Strike-Engine-Source
请注意: 正如一些玩家反馈,Vega Strike 的学习曲线可能比较陡峭,尤其是对于新手。操作方式相对复杂,游戏初期可能缺乏明确的引导。建议新玩家:
- 查阅官方文档或社区 Wiki。
- 观看在线教程视频。
- 访问社区论坛寻求帮助。
安装和配置过程中也可能遇到一些问题(例如兼容性、配置调整),社区论坛是寻找解决方案的好地方。
使用场景/案例
Vega Strike 适用于多种场景:
- 太空模拟爱好者: 体验经典的太空贸易、战斗和探索玩法,享受高度的自由度和社区内容。
- Mod 创作者: 利用其模块化引擎和工具,创建自定义的飞船、任务、甚至全新的太空游戏。
- 游戏开发者/学习者: 研究其开源代码,学习 C++、OpenGL 和游戏引擎架构。
玩家评价与社区反馈
社区对 Vega Strike 的评价呈现多元化:
- 优点:
- 免费和开源: 这是其最大的吸引力之一。
- 自由度和深度: 广阔的宇宙和多样的玩法受到赞赏。
- 强大的 Mod 支持: 社区贡献极大地丰富了游戏内容和可玩性。
- 有潜力的引擎: 其底层框架具有一定的灵活性。
- 缺点:
- 画面相对过时: 与现代商业太空模拟游戏相比,原生画面较为陈旧(但可通过 Mod 改善)。
- 学习曲线陡峭: 操作复杂,缺乏完善的新手引导。
- Bug 和稳定性: 部分玩家报告遇到 Bug 或稳定性问题,尤其是在安装 Mod 后。
- 性能: 在较旧的硬件上可能存在性能瓶颈,过度使用高分辨率 Mod 也可能影响性能。
许多玩家认为,如果你能接受其视觉上的年代感并愿意投入时间学习,Vega Strike 及其 Mod 能提供不亚于某些商业游戏的深度和乐趣。
与类似工具对比
特性 | Vega Strike | Elite Dangerous | Oolite | Freelancer (经典) |
---|---|---|---|---|
价格/许可 | 免费 / 开源 (GPL) | 付费 / 商业 | 免费 / 开源 (GPL) | 付费 / 商业 (现已较难购买) |
平台 | Windows, macOS, Linux | Windows, (曾有 PS4/Xbox) | Windows, macOS, Linux | Windows |
画面 | 较过时 (可通过 Mod 改善) | 现代, 高质量 | 复古风格 (致敬经典 Elite) | 较过时 |
Mod 支持 | 非常强大, 社区活跃 | 有限 (官方支持较少) | 强大, 社区活跃 | 有 Mod 社区, 但不如 VS/Oolite 开放 |
学习曲线 | 陡峭 | 中等 | 中等 | 相对较低 |
核心玩法 | 贸易, 战斗, 探索 (沙盒) | 贸易, 战斗, 探索, 多人 (MMO-lite) | 贸易, 战斗, 探索 (经典 Elite 精神续作) | 贸易, 战斗, 探索 (剧情驱动+沙盒元素) |
引擎 | 自研 (C++/OpenGL) | Cobra Engine | 自研 (Objective-C/OpenGL) | 自研 |
总结
Vega Strike 是一款充满潜力的开源太空模拟游戏和引擎。虽然它在画面和新手友好度方面可能不及现代商业大作,但其免费、开源、跨平台以及极其强大的 Modding 社区,使其在太空模拟游戏领域占据了独特的地位。对于喜欢自由探索、深度定制和乐于投入时间学习的玩家,或者希望基于现有框架创建自己太空内容的开发者来说,Vega Strike 绝对值得一试。
积极参与其社区,无论是寻求帮助、分享经验还是贡献 Mod,都是体验 Vega Strike 完整魅力的关键。
相关链接:
- GitHub: https://github.com/vegastrike/Vega-Strike-Engine-Source
- SourceForge (可能包含论坛和旧版下载): https://sourceforge.net/projects/vegastrike/
(请注意检查这些链接的当前有效性和活跃度)
评论(0)